🔧 Applying Database Fixes...

🔍 Verification Results:

✅ Vendors view: 0 records accessible

✅ Active workflow rules: 12

✅ User roles: admin(4) (4) hod(2) finance(2) procurement(2) md(1)

✅ Active categories: 5

Database Fix Results

🔧 Database Fix Results

Applied Fixes:

✅ Fixed vendor_ratings foreign key constraint
✅ Ensured workflow rules exist (6 new rules added)
✅ Updated user roles (0 users updated)
✅ Added test users with proper roles (0 new users)
✅ Activated procurement categories (0 categories updated)
✅ Cleaned up test data (0 test requests removed)

Errors:

❌ Error creating vendors view: SQLSTATE[HY000]: General error: 1347 'irtqnoel_procurement_system.vendors' is not VIEW

Next Steps:

Now run the fixed test to verify everything is working:

Run Fixed Test Test Procurement Form Test Approval Dashboard

Test User Credentials:

Username/Password: password123 (for all test users)